CHRISTMAS SANDWICH CREMES



Christmas Sandwich Cremes image

Delicate,light, flaky, melt in your mouth pastry cookies are filled with sweet cream filling. Such a wonderful delicious cookie you'll have to have more than one!

Provided by Norine Rogers

Categories     Holiday Dishes

Time 2h17m

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cup butter (no substitutions), softened
1/3 cup heavy whipping cream
2 cups all-purpose flour
Sugar for coating
1/2 cup butter (no substitutions), softened
1 1/2 cups confectioners' s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
Food Coloring

Steps:

  • In a mixing bowl, with the paddle attachment, combine butter, cream and flour. Mix will.
  • Cover in plastic wrap and refrigerate for 2 hours or until dough is easy to handle.
  • Divide dough into thirds; let one portion stand at room temperature for 15 minutes (keep remaining dough refrigerated until ready to roll out).
  • On a floured surface, roll out dough to 1/8 inch thickness.
  • Cut with a 1 -1/2 inch round cookie cutter. Place cutouts in a shallow dish filled with sugar. Gently press cookie into sugar. Turn to coat.
  • Place cookies on a silicone lined, or parchment lined, baking sheet. Prick with a fork several times.
  • Bake at 375° for 7-9 minutes or until set.
  • Cool on parchment lined wire rack.
  • For filling, in a mixing bowl, cream butter and sugar. Add vanilla. Tint with food coloring. Spread about 1 teaspoon of filling over half of the cookies; top with remaining cookies.

PEPPERMINT CREAM SANDWICH COOKIES



Peppermint Cream Sandwich Cookies image

My mother and I made these crisp chocolate peppermint sandwich cookies together. They are a perfect addition to any party. —Donna Williamson, Round Rock, Texas

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 45m

Yield 2 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 14

1-1/2 cups butter, softened
1-1/2 cups sugar
2 large eggs, room temperature
3 cups all-purpose flour
2/3 cup baking cocoa
2 teaspoons instant espresso pow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
FILLING:
1/2 cup butter, softened
1 teaspoon peppermint extract
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2-1/2 cups confectioners' sugar
1 tablespoon 2% milk
Red food coloring, optional

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y, 5-7 minutes. Beat in eggs. In another bowl, whisk flour, cocoa, espresso powder and salt; gradually beat into creamed mixture., Divide dough in half. Shape each half into a disk; cover. Refrigerate 1 hour or until firm enough to roll., Preheat oven to 350°. On a lightly floured surface, roll 1 portion of dough to 1/4-in. thickness. Cut with a floured 2-1/2-in. fluted round cookie cutter. Place 1 in. apart on parchment-lined baking sheets. Bake 10-12 minutes or until firm. Remove from pans to wire racks to cool completely. Repeat with remaining dough., In a large bowl, beat butter and extracts until creamy. Beat in confectioners' sugar, alternately with milk, until smooth. Tint as desired with food coloring. Spread frosting on bottoms of half of the cookies; cover with remaining cookies.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ator.

CHRISTMAS SANDWICH COOKIES



Christmas Sandwich Cookies image

My mother-in-law gave me the recipe for these lovely melt-in-your-mouth cookies. They're a Christmas tradition at our house. -Elizabeth Klager, St. Catharines, Ontario

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 45m

Yield 2 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 cup butter, softened
1/2 cup confectioners' sugar
2 teaspoon milk
2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 cup cornstarch
1/8 teaspoon salt
FILLING:
5 tablespoons raspberry jam
FROSTING:
1/4 cup butter, softened
1 cup confectioners' s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Green food coloring
Quartered red candied cherries and star-shaped sprinkles

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and confectioners' sugar until light and fluffy. Add milk. Combine the flour, cornstarch and salt; add to the creamed mixture, beating just until dough forms a ball. , On a lightly floured surface, knead 20 times. Roll out 3/8-in. thickness. Cut with a 2-in. round cookie cutter. Place 1 in. apart on ungreased baking sheets. , Bake at 350° for 12-13 minutes or until edges are lightly browned. Remove to wire racks to cool. Spread jam over the bottom of half of the cookies; top with remaining cookies. , In a large bowl, beat the butter, confectioners' sugar, vanilla and food coloring until smooth. Place mixture in a heavy-duty resealable plastic bag; cut a small hole in a corner of bag. Pipe frosting in tree shapes on cookies. Garnish with candied cherries and sprinkles.
